Faf du Plessis Century Leads Texas Super Kings to Opening Win
4.2
(21)

The MLC (Major League Cricket) 2026 season started with Texas Super Kings taking on Seattle Orcas. The two teams met at Grand Prairie Stadium in Dallas on June 19, and the match ended up being all about veteran South Africa batter Faf du Plessis.

Tim Seifert and Shayan Jahangir Power Orcas to Massive Score

Seattle Orcas batted first, and their opening pair was aggressive from the start. Tim Seifert scored a century, scoring 104 runs off 66 balls, while Shayan Jahangir scored 78 runs off 47 balls, which led the Orcas to a score of 220 runs.

Faf du Plessis Leads Texas Super Kings to Victory

Chasing a big target, Texas Super Kings needed something special, and captain Faf du Plessis delivered just that. The 41-year-old South African showed that age is no barrier as he scored his fourth MLC century.

He completed his century in just 45 balls and remained unbeaten on 113 off 52 balls. His innings helped the Super Kings chase down the target in 18.3 overs as they started the new season with six wickets.

Faf du Plessis Reflects on His Match-Winning Knock

After the match, Faf du Plessis spoke about his innings and shared his thoughts on the Dallas pitch. He said that he always enjoys batting on this pitch and added that he would be happy if the entire tournament was played there.

“It’s a great wicket, I always enjoy batting here. I wish the entire tournament was here. There was pressure on the ball, they scored big and hit two sixes at the back-end. But we started the game during the batting PP. They batted well, but you can see it was a good wicket, the ball came nicely and I’m proud of the way the boys came back,” said du Plessis during the post-match presentation ceremony.

Texas Super Kings Set for Next Challenge

With a win over Seattle Orcas, the Texas Super Kings will now face the San Francisco Unicorns. The two teams will face each other in the fourth match of the tournament in Dallas on June 20.
